The home team has won the last two games played between the two teams, and overall, the Red Wings have won each of the last three games. This is the first meeting between the two teams this season, but last March the Red Wings secured the 4-3 in overtime.Â
Red Wings Coming off Key WinÂ
The Red Wings haven’t had the best season but they are coming off a key win in the last game. The Red Wings scored four goals against the Pittsburgh Penguins and that was enough for the two-goal victory. The Red Wings scored two goals in the third period to lock up the win. Jonathan Berggren finished with one assist and one goal. J.T. Compher also was good scoring a goal and adding an assist. The Red Wings actually have won two games in a row and they hope this is the exact momentum they need to turn their season around.Â
The Red Wings are averaging 2.62 goals while their defense is giving up 3.24 goals per game. The offense is ranked 28th in the league while the defense is ranked 25th. They are averaging only 25.1 shots per game which is 31st in the league. The good news for the Red Wings is they are pretty healthy heading into this game.Â

Blue Jackets Off a Shutout Win
The Blue Jackets are coming off a shootout win and they were able to pull out late against the Carolina Hurricanes. The Blue Jackets had three goals against the Carolina Hurricanes and then ended up securing the win in a shootout. Kirill Marchenko had a huge game putting up two goals and finished with six shots on goal. Two games ago against the Boston Bruins, they really struggled and they ended up losing 4-0. The Blue Jackets on the season are averaging 3.29 goals while their defense is giving up 3.58 goals per game. The offense is ranked 9th in the league while the defense is ranked 31st. They are averaging 30.08 shots per game, which is also the eighth-best in the NHL. The Blue Jackets are dealing with some injury issues heading into this game. Center Boone Jenner is dealing with a shoulder injury and he’s going to be out for a while.Â
